Minutes of the IESG Teleconferences

    INTERNET ENGINEERING STEERING GROUP (IESG)
    April 11, 1996

    Reported by: Steve Coya, IETF Executive Director

    This report contains IESG meeting notes, positions and action items.

    These minutes were compiled by the IETF Secretariat which is supported
    by the National Science Foundation under Grant No. NCR-9528103

    Minutes
    -------
    1. The IESG approved the minutes from the March 28 IESG telechat. Coya
    to place in shadow directories.

    2. The IESG approved publication of GSS-API Authentication Method for
    SOCKS Version 5 <draft-ietf-aft-gssapi-02.txt> as a Proposed
    Standard.

    3. The IESG approved publication of The Kerberos Version 5 GSS-API
    Mechanism <draft-ietf-cat-kerb5gss-06.txt> as a Proposed Standard.

    4. The IESG decided to return Domain Name System Security Extensions
    <draft-ietf-dnssec-secext-09.txt> to the author for clarification
    and other changes. Harald is to provide a more complete list to
    Jeff, who will convey to the author. This document is removed from
    the IESG agenda, and will be considered after a new version of the
    Internet-Draft is made available.

    5. The IESG approved publication of Neighbor Discovery for IP Version
    6 (IPv6) <draft-ietf-ipngwg-discovery-06.txt> as a Proposed
    Standard.

    6. The IESG approved publication of IPv6 Stateless Address
    Autoconfiguration <draft-ietf-addrconf-ipv6-auto-07.txt> as a
    Proposed Standard.

    7. The draft charter for Uniform Resource Characteristics (urc) was
    withdrawn from consideration by the IESG. This will be
    recondsidered when a new charter is developed and submitted.

    8. A decision on Native ATM Support in the Internet
    <draft-rfced-info-jackowski-00.txt>, a candidate for Informational
    RFC, was deferred to permit more time for IESG review. It was noted
    that when published, the title WILL have to be changed.

    9. WG ACtions:

    a. The IPNG Working Group is to be transferred to the Internet Area.
    b. Addrconf is to be closed down. Any future work will be handled
    by the IPNG Working Group.
    c. The IPNG Area will close once the final two documents (An IPv6
    Provider-Based Unicast Address Format & Path MTU Discovery for
    IP version 6) are processed.

    10. Note of Apprecation: The IESG commended Scott Bradner and Allison
    Mankin for the outstanding job they performed as co-Area Directors of
    the IPNG Area, and thanked them for taking on the job.
